Is Caesar more famous than napoleon?

The fame of Julius Caesar and Napoleon Bonaparte can vary depending on cultural context and historical perspective. Caesar is often recognized for his role in the transition from the Roman Republic to the Roman Empire, and his influence on Western civilization is profound. Napoleon, on the other hand, is known for his military strategies and the establishment of legal codes in Europe. Ultimately, both figures are iconic, but Caesar may have a slight edge in historical significance due to his foundational role in ancient history.

Who is more famous Mick Jagger or Bob Marley?

Both Mick Jagger and Bob Marley are iconic figures in music, but their fame is rooted in different genres and cultural contexts. Jagger, as the lead singer of The Rolling Stones, is a symbol of rock music and has had a long-lasting influence on the genre. Bob Marley, on the other hand, is often regarded as the face of reggae music and has had a profound impact on global culture and social movements. Ultimately, their fame may vary depending on geographic and cultural factors, but both are legendary in their own right.
